1.
The Great Migration in the Serengeti
One
of the most spectacular events in the animal kingdom is the Great Migration,
where millions of wildebeest, zebras, and gazelles make their way across the
Serengeti plains. Tanzania
Wildlife Safari enthusiasts flock to witness this awe-inspiring
journey, which is a key highlight of any Tanzania Safari Tour. The sight
of thousands of animals crossing the Mara River, often followed by dramatic
predator-prey encounters, is truly a once-in-a-lifetime experience.
2.
Ngorongoro Crater – A Wildlife Haven
The
Ngorongoro
Crater, a UNESCO World Heritage site, is one of the best places for Tanzania
Wildlife Experiences. It’s home to a stunning variety of animals, including
the Big Five: lions, elephants, buffaloes, leopards, and rhinos. A Safari Tour in Tanzania
to this crater offers an opportunity to witness diverse wildlife in an area
that has remained relatively unchanged for thousands of years. The crater’s
lush landscape provides a perfect backdrop for incredible wildlife sightings.
3.
Tarangire National Park – Elephant Paradise
For
those who love elephants, Tarangire
National Park offers one of the best experiences in Tanzania. With its
massive elephant herds roaming the park, you’ll have the chance to see these
magnificent creatures up close. A Safari in Tanzania to Tarangire is
also perfect for birdwatchers, as the park is home to over 500 species of
birds, making it a hidden gem for nature lovers.
4.
Selous Game Reserve – Off-the-Beaten-Path Adventure
If
you’re looking for a more secluded and authentic wildlife experience, the Selous
Game Reserve offers a tranquil alternative to the more popular parks. This
lesser-known gem allows you to enjoy Tanzania Safari
Holidays away from the crowds. The reserve is home to vast populations
of elephants, lions, and wild dogs. It’s also one of the few places where you
can go on a boat safari, offering an entirely unique way to explore Tanzania’s
waterways.
